npm 包 micblog 使用教程

AI 编程助手,豆包旗下的编程助手,提供智能补全、智能预测、智能问答等能力,节省开发时间,释放脑海中的创造力,支持 VSCode,点击体验 AI

简介

Micblog 是一个简单而强大的前端微博组件,可用于快速搭建微博模块。它能够轻松地与 React、Vue、Angular 等前端框架集成,提供了一系列功能如发微博、点赞、评论、私信等。Micblog 包含了微博组件的前端 UI 和微博数据的后端 API。

安装

要使用 Micblog,你需要先安装它。安装 Micblog 很简单,只需在命令行运行:

--- ------- -------

---- --- -------

安装完成后,你可以使用 Micblog 的所有功能。

使用

Micblog 可以轻松集成到你的前端应用中,以下是使用 Micblog 的具体步骤:

1. 导入样式表

在 HTML/CSS 中导入 Micblog 样式表:

----- ---------------- ---------------------------

2. 初始化 Micblog

在 JavaScript 中初始化 Micblog:

----- ------- - --- ----------------

其中 options 是一个对象,包含了 Micblog 的配置信息。以下是 options 的详细说明:

  • el: (必填)Micblog 容器的 DOM 元素,可以是一个 CSS 选择器字符串或一个 DOM 元素对象。
  • apiUrl: (必填)Micblog 的后端 API 地址。
  • user: (选填)当前用户的信息,包含 idname 等字段,默认为 null
  • debug: (选填)是否开启调试模式,默认为 false

3. 发送微博

在 Micblog 中发送微博很简单,只需调用 micblog.createPost(content, callback) 方法:

----- ------- - --------
--------------------------- -------- ----- ----- -
  -- ----- -
    ------------------
  - ---- -
    --------------------------- - -------------
  -
--

4. 获取微博列表

要获取微博列表,调用 micblog.getPosts(options, callback) 方法:

------------------ ------ --- ------- - -- -------- ----- ------ -
  -- ----- -
    ------------------
  - ---- -
    ---------------------- ------ -
      -------------------------
    --
  -
--

其中 options 包含了获取微博列表的参数,如 limit 表示返回的微博数量限制,offset 表示偏移量等等。

5. 其他

Micblog 还提供了点赞、评论、私信等功能,具体用法请参考 Micblog 文档。

示例代码

以下是一个完整的 Micblog 示例:

--------- -----
------
------
  ----- ----------------
  -------------- ------------
  ----- ---------------- ---------------------------
-------
------
  ---- -------------------
  ------- --------------------------------------
  --------
    ----- ------- - --- ---------
      --- -----------
      ------- -----------------------------
      ----- - --- ---- ----- ------ --
      ------ -----
    --

    ---------------------------- -------- ----- ----- -
      -- ----- -
        ------------------
      - ---- -
        --------------------------- - -------------
      -
    --

    ------------------ ------ --- ------- - -- -------- ----- ------ -
      -- ----- -
        ------------------
      - ---- -
        ---------------------- ------ -
          -------------------------
        --
      -
    --
  ---------
-------
-------

通过以上的示例,你已经可以轻松地使用 Micblog 了。欢迎进一步了解 Micblog 的更多功能,希望对你的前端开发工作有所帮助!

来源:JavaScript中文网 ,转载请联系管理员! 本文地址:https://www.javascriptcn.com/post/60066f471d8e776d0804103d


猜你喜欢

  • npm 包 oauthlib 使用教程

    什么是 oauthlib 首先,我们需要了解 oauthlib 是什么。oauthlib 是一个 Node.js 的 OAuth 1 和 OAuth 2 协议实现库,它可以帮助我们实现与第三方平台的授...

    4 年前
  • npm 包 object-literal-string-to-object 使用教程

    前言 在前端开发中,我们经常需要处理一些从服务端返回来的 JSON 字符串,然后将其转换为 JavaScript 对象,以便进行进一步的处理和渲染。但是,有时候我们可能会遇到一个特殊的问题,即我们从服...

    4 年前
  • npm 包 object-localizer 使用教程

    简介 object-localizer 是一个用于本地化对象的 npm 包。它的目的是让前端开发人员能够更加轻松地本地化他们的应用程序,并允许他们在应用程序中使用多种语言。

    4 年前
  • npm 包 object-meta 使用教程

    在前端开发中,经常需要对对象进行元数据的存储和读取。npm 包 object-meta 提供了一种简单而强大的方式来管理对象的元数据。本文将介绍如何使用 object-meta 包。

    4 年前
  • npm 包 nvd3-browserified 使用教程

    在前端开发中,数据可视化是非常重要的一环。nvd3-browserified 是一个基于 D3.js 的可视化库,为我们提供了丰富的图表类型和功能。本篇文章将介绍如何使用 npm 包 nvd3-bro...

    4 年前
  • npm 包 nvb 使用教程

    简介 nvb 是一个基于 Vue.js 的 UI 组件库,拥有丰富的组件和插件。通过使用 nvb,可以快速搭建出美观、易用的前端界面。 本教程将介绍如何在你的项目中使用 nvb,以及如何使用其中的几个...

    4 年前
  • npm 包 NVA-UI 使用教程

    NVA-UI 是一个便捷的 UI 框架库,它提供了一系列的组件和样式,可以帮助我们快速构建一个漂亮、易用的前端应用。在本篇文章中,我们将详细介绍如何使用 NVA-UI。

    4 年前
  • npm 包 nvar 使用教程

    简介 nvar 是一个 npm 包,它能够让你在 JavaScript 代码中方便地使用变量。使用 nvar,你可以将变量的值存储在配置文件中,并在代码的任何地方轻松访问这些变量。

    4 年前
  • npm 包 object-match 使用教程

    在前端开发中,我们常常会遇到需要处理对象的情况。如果想要对对象进行比较或筛选,我们需要进行复杂的判断和遍历。这时候,npm 包 object-match 就可以帮助我们轻松地完成这些操作。

    4 年前
  • npm 包 `object-max` 使用教程

    object-max 是一个 npm 包,它提供了一些处理对象的功能,可以帮助我们方便地获取对象中最大的值,并返回其对应的键。 安装 首先,我们需要安装 object-max。

    4 年前
  • Statement lambda 可以被表达式 lambda 替换

    在 JavaScript 中,我们可以使用箭头函数来定义 lambda(匿名函数)。在 ES6 之前,箭头函数只支持表达式语法,而不支持语句语法。这意味着你不能在一个箭头函数中写多个语句或使用条件分支...

    4 年前
  • npm 包 object-merge-stream 使用教程

    前言 在前端开发中,我们难免会遇到需要合并多个对象的情况。如果我们手动地完成合并操作,不仅费时费力,代码量也很大。此时,npm 包 object-merge-stream 就可以提供一个快速简便的解决...

    4 年前
  • npm 包 object-md5 使用教程

    简介 在前端开发中,为了保障数据的安全性,我们通常使用散列计算来生成数据的摘要。其中,MD5 算法是目前最常用的一种算法之一。通过计算输入数据的散列值,可以很好地保证数据的完整性和一致性。

    4 年前
  • npm包 nyt-top 使用教程

    在前端开发中,我们经常需要获取新闻数据来呈现给用户。而 nyt-top 是一款能够帮助我们获取纽约时报的新闻数据的 npm 包。本文将会详细介绍 nyt-top 的使用方法及相关的知识点,帮助你加深对...

    4 年前
  • npm 包 nytdistricts 使用教程

    随着 Web 开发的不断发展,前端技术也变得日益复杂。其中一个重要的发展方向是数据可视化,由此诞生了各种新型的数据可视化工具。在这些工具中,nytdistricts 是一个用于可视化美国区域地图的 n...

    4 年前
  • NPM 包 ob-module 使用教程

    作为前端开发者,我们必须熟悉各种NPM包,以提高我们的工作效率。在本文中,我将向大家介绍一个名为 ob-module 的 NPM 包。 ob-module 是一个实用的前端模块化解决方案,它可以帮助我...

    4 年前
  • NPM 包 OB-SCENE 使用教程

    在前端开发中,我们经常需要对文本进行敏感词过滤,以免出现不当的内容。而 NPM 包 OB-SCENE 刚好为我们提供了一种解决方案,它可以通过预设敏感词列表,自动进行过滤并替换。

    4 年前
  • npm 包 ob.js 使用教程

    简介 ob.js 是一个轻量级的 JavaScript 库,用于监听对象的变化并触发回调函数。通过这个库,我们可以在前端开发中方便地实现数据绑定和自动更新视图的功能,极大地提升开发效率和代码质量。

    4 年前
  • npm 包 oba 使用教程

    前言 前端开发过程中,我们经常会使用各种 npm 包来方便开发。其中,oba 套件是一个轻量级的对象绑定框架,可以使得数据和视图之间实现同步,并可以方便的处理各种数据和事件。

    4 年前
  • npm 包 nvd3-revlucio 使用教程

    什么是 nvd3-revlucio ? nvd3-revlucio 是一个基于 D3.js 和 nvd3 的可视化库,具有更高的可扩展性。它提供了一系列漂亮的图表和图形,包括线图、饼状图、散点图等等。

    4 年前

相关推荐

    暂无文章